## Dispatch Timing Model

Liftwright's simulator core advances in fixed ticks, and plugin authors should assume dispatch decisions are evaluated once per tick, never mid-tick. Door dwell, acceleration ramps, and hall-call aging are all expressed in tick units, so a plugin that overrides the scoring function must normalize its weights against the same timebase. Deviating from these defaults will invalidate the bundled regression scenarios. The tuning constants used by the reference dispatcher are listed below.

tuning table, kajog-kawef:
PRIORITIES = {
    "kelox": 870,
    "kasix": 89,
    "eliax": 988,
}

## Authentication

The Furrowgate telemetry gateway requires every support-initiated diagnostic session to authenticate against the internal fleet-registry service before device data can be pulled. Support staff should use the shared service credential rather than personal logins, as personal accounts lack the telemetry-read scope. Sessions expire after thirty minutes of inactivity and must be re-established with the same credential. Keep this value out of ticket notes and chat logs. The credential is as follows.

API key for yahig-tadup: kto7_ubizbYm

## Runbook: Relay Gateway Release

Before promoting the Marlet relay build, confirm websocket compression settings. Permessage-deflate cuts bandwidth roughly 40% but raises CPU and memory per connection; disable it if the Torvane cluster is above 70% load. Document your choice in the release notes. Verify the artifact signature using the key below.

rollout seal: bky4_x7Gc